In France, the consumption of organic products has been growing for several years.
In 2017, the country had $52\%$ women. That same year, $92\%$ of French people had already consumed organic products. Furthermore, among consumers of organic products, $55\%$ were women.
We randomly choose a person from the file of French people in 2017. We denote:
- $F$ the event ``the chosen person is a woman'';
- $H$ the event ``the chosen person is a man'';
- $B$ the event ``the chosen person has already consumed organic products''.
- Translate the numerical data from the statement using events $F$ and $B$.
- a. Show that $P(F \cap B) = 0{,}506$. b. Deduce the probability that a person consumed organic products in 2017, given that they are a woman.
- Calculate $P_H(\bar{B})$. Interpret this result in the context of the exercise.
